//! MST Node - represents a node in the Merkle Search Tree.
//!
//! Each node has a key depth and contains entries that may have subtrees.
use super::mst_entry::MstEntry;
/// Represents a node in the MST.
#[derive(Debug, Clone)]
pub struct MstNode {
/// The key depth of this node in the tree
pub key_depth: i32,
/// Optional left subtree
pub left_tree: Option<Box<MstNode>>,
/// Entries in this node (sorted by key)
pub entries: Vec<MstEntry>,
}
impl MstNode {
/// Creates a new empty MstNode at the given key depth.
pub fn new(key_depth: i32) -> Self {
Self {
key_depth,
left_tree: None,
entries: Vec::new(),
}
}
/// Creates a new MstNode with entries.
pub fn with_entries(key_depth: i32, entries: Vec<MstEntry>) -> Self {
Self {
key_depth,
left_tree: None,
entries,
}
}
/// Sets the left subtree.
pub fn set_left_tree(&mut self, left: MstNode) {
self.left_tree = Some(Box::new(left));
}
}
impl PartialEq for MstNode {
fn eq(&self, other: &Self) -> bool {
if self.key_depth != other.key_depth {
return false;
}
match (&self.left_tree, &other.left_tree) {
(None, None) => {}
(Some(a), Some(b)) if a == b => {}
_ => return false,
}
if self.entries.len() != other.entries.len() {
return false;
}
for (a, b) in self.entries.iter().zip(other.entries.iter()) {
if a != b {
return false;
}
}
true
}
}
impl Eq for MstNode {}
impl std::hash::Hash for MstNode {
fn hash<H: std::hash::Hasher>(&self, state: &mut H) {
self.key_depth.hash(state);
// Note: left_tree and entries are not fully hashed to avoid complexity
self.entries.len().hash(state);
}
}
